Tylor Megill, Mets routed by MLB-best Braves in series-opening loss

Everything was going well for Tylor Megill until it wasn’t.

The Mets were routed by the Atlanta Braves 7-0 in the first game of a three-game series Friday night at Citi Field. Megill, the right-hander who has confounded the Mets with his struggles this season, was responsible for six of those runs (five earned) in his sixth loss of the season (6-6).

However, the loss can’t fully be blamed on Megill. There were defensive miscues behind the big righty and there were empty at-bats against Charlie Morton and the NL-best Braves.
